Corporate Citizen
Refers to a business seen as a member of society, which is expected to participate responsibly in the community and environment it operates within.
Voluntary Dimension
The aspect of social responsibility where businesses participate in charitable activities or philanthropy by choice rather than obligation.
Right to Be Heard
A consumer right that guarantees individuals the opportunity to provide feedback, complaints, or to be part of the decision-making process regarding products or services they use.
